Political parties urged to cooperate in transparent electoral roll preparation

By Sohail Khan 24 August 2026, 11:20 pm

All political parties should cooperate in preparing a transparent electoral roll and submit written objections with supporting evidence if they find discrepancies in the draft roll, Visakhapatnam district Roll Observer S. Bhargavi said on Monday.

Ms. Bhargavi, who is also Director of Tribal Welfare, reviewed the Special Intensive Revision (SIR)-2026 process at a meeting with representatives of recognised political parties and Electoral Registration Officers (EROs), along with District Collector Abhishikth Kishore, at the Collectorate.

She reviewed reports on the issue and collection of forms, publication of the draft roll, notices to voters who had not returned forms, and the identification of voters who had died or migrated. She also reviewed the status of Forms 6, 7 and 8. She said 1,04,866 persons aged 18 and 19 were estimated to be eligible for enrolment based on the projected 2026 population, but only 4,787 had been registered. She directed officials to conduct a special drive to enrol eligible young voters.

Ms. Bhargavi said voter enumeration in the district was better than in other districts and appreciated the efforts of the Collector and officials. She directed officials to accelerate voter enrolment and conduct field-level verification of voters who had died, migrated or failed to return forms.

She said any one of the 11 official identity documents prescribed by the Election Commission could be considered for identifying voters whose records had not been mapped and called for greater awareness among voters.

She urged political parties to cooperate at the booth level and submit written complaints with supporting evidence on corrections and duplicate enrolments. EROs were asked to expedite disposal of pending Forms 6, 7 and 8 and prepare constituency-wise action plans.

Mr. Kishore asked officials to scrutinise the reasons and supporting documents when absent, migrated or deleted voters apply afresh through Form 6. He also asked political parties to appoint booth-level agents for 163 newly established polling stations.
